Platinum rhodium wire thermocouple finished product packaging equipment
By designing finished product packaging equipment for platinum-rhodium wire thermocouples and using mechanized components to achieve automatic rotation and positioning of the grid disk, the problem of thermocouples falling due to manual operation is solved, and production efficiency and packaging convenience are improved.

[0001] The utility model relates to the technical field of thermocouple production, in particular to a device for packaging finished products of platinum-rhodium wire thermocouples. Background Art
[0002] Thermocouples are commonly used temperature measuring elements in temperature measuring instruments. They directly measure temperature and convert the temperature signal into a thermoelectromotive force signal, which is then converted into the temperature of the measured medium through an electrical instrument (secondary instrument). The appearance of various thermocouples often varies greatly depending on the needs, but their basic structure is roughly the same. They usually consist of main parts such as the thermode, insulating sleeve protection tube and junction box. They are usually used in conjunction with display instruments, recording instruments and electronic regulators. In industrial production processes, temperature is one of the important parameters that need to be measured and controlled. In temperature measurement, thermocouples are extremely widely used. They have many advantages such as simple structure, easy manufacturing, wide measurement range, high accuracy, low inertia and easy remote transmission of output signals. Therefore, they are widely used.
[0003] In addition, since the thermocouple is a passive sensor, it does not require an external power supply for measurement and is very convenient to use. Therefore, it is often used to measure the temperature of gas or liquid in furnaces and pipelines and the surface temperature of solids. In the production process of thermocouples, the final molding of the thermocouple is cast in a grid tray, and then the formed thermocouple is placed in the grid tray. When the thermocouple is packaged, the grid trays are removed from the cart one by one, and the thermocouples placed on the grid trays are dumped into the packaging bag, and then packaged. However, since the grid trays need to be manually removed and dumped, the thermocouples are often easy to fall off, and the manual method further reduces the production efficiency. For this reason, we propose a finished product packaging equipment for platinum-rhodium wire thermocouples. Utility Model Content
[0004] The utility model provides a platinum-rhodium wire thermocouple finished product packaging device, which solves the problems raised by the above background technology.
[0005] To achieve the above objectives, the present invention is implemented through the following technical solutions: a platinum-rhodium wire thermocouple finished product packaging equipment, including a grid plate and a packaging frame, the grid plate is placed in the packaging frame, the bottom end of the packaging frame is fixed with a support frame that can be sleeved with a packaging bag, the outside of the support frame is fixed with a plurality of suction cups that adsorb and limit the packaging bag, the interior of the packaging frame is movably connected with a movable plate that can move relatively, and the movable plate can support the grid plate, and a rotatable rotating cylinder is movably sleeved on the inner walls on both sides of the packaging frame, and a retractable cross-linking shaft is movably connected inside the rotating cylinder, and the cross-linking shaft can be plugged into the grid plate.
[0006] Optionally, the two inner walls inside the packaging frame are movably connected with a positioning plate with an arc-shaped upper surface, one end of the positioning plate extends into the packaging frame and is fixed with a first spring, and one end of the first spring is fixed to the packaging frame.
[0007] Optionally, slots are provided in the middle of both sides of the grid disk, and the slots can be plugged into the cross-linked shaft. One end of the cross-linked shaft extends out of the packaging frame and is fixedly connected to an electric push rod, and one end of the electric push rod is fixedly connected to a disc. The outer sides of both ends of the packaging frame are fixedly connected to fixed frames, and the disc is movably mounted on the fixed frame.
[0008] Optionally, one end of the two movable plates extends out of the packaging frame and is fixedly connected to the first transmission frame and the second transmission frame respectively, and one end of the rotating cylinder extends out of the packaging frame and is fixedly connected to the gear ring, and the two ends of the first transmission frame and the second transmission frame are respectively engaged with the two gear rings.
[0009] Optionally, the outer side of one end of the packaging frame is connected to a gear via a rotating shaft, and a motor is fixedly connected to one of the fixing frames, and the output shaft of the motor passes through the fixing frame and is connected to the gear.
[0010] Optionally, the other end of the movable plate is movably connected to a plurality of support columns, a support plate is fixed to the top of the support column, the bottom of the support plate is in contact with the bottom of the grid disk, and a second spring is sleeved on the support column, the top of the second spring is fixed to the bottom of the support plate, and the bottom end of the second spring is fixed to the movable plate.
[0011] The utility model has the following beneficial effects:
[0012] 1. The platinum-rhodium wire thermocouple finished product packaging equipment is driven by a cross-linked shaft to rotate the grid disk, and then dump the thermocouples on the grid disk, so that the thermocouples can smoothly fall into the packaging bag installed on the support frame, thereby making the packaging of the thermocouples more convenient and more intelligent.
[0013] 2. The finished product packaging equipment of platinum-rhodium wire thermocouple, under the action of the first spring force, enables the positioning plate to push the grid disk for automatic positioning to calibrate the relative position of the slot, so that the slot can be smoothly aligned with the cross-linked shaft, and then the cross-linked shaft can be smoothly inserted into the slot, so that the cross-linked shaft can be smoothly transmitted.
[0014] 3. The finished product packaging equipment of platinum-rhodium wire thermocouples enables the first transmission frame and the second transmission frame to move relative to each other under the action of the rotation of the gear ring, and drives the two movable plates to move relative to each other, so that the support plate is separated from the contact with the grid disk, thereby enabling the grid disk to rotate smoothly. At the same time, after the cross-linked shaft is pulled out of the slot, the grid disk can smoothly fall through the packaging frame to discharge the material, making it more convenient to use. [0022] See also Figures 1 to 5A finished product packaging device for platinum-rhodium wire thermocouples includes a grid plate 1 and a packaging frame 2. The grid plate 1 is placed in the packaging frame 2. A support frame 5 that can be sleeved with a packaging bag is fixed at the bottom end of the packaging frame 2. The packaging bag can be opened by the support frame 5 so that the thermocouple poured out of the packaging frame 2 can fall smoothly into the packaging bag. A plurality of suction cups 6 for adsorbing and limiting the packaging bag are fixed on the outside of the support frame 5. Under the action of the suction cups 6, the packaging bag can be stably installed on the support frame 5. The interior of the packaging frame 2 is movably connected with a relatively movable movable plate 14, and the movable plate 14 can move relative to the packaging bag. The grid disk 1 is supported, so that the grid disk 1 can be loaded smoothly, and a rotatable rotating cylinder 18 is movably mounted on the inner walls on both sides of the packaging frame 2. The rotating cylinder 18 can be rotated in a fixed position on the packaging frame 2, and a retractable cross-linked shaft 17 is movably connected in the rotating cylinder 18. The cross-linked shaft 17 can be plugged into the grid disk 1, and driven by the rotating cylinder 18, the cross-linked shaft 17 can rotate, and then under the rotation action of the cross-linked shaft 17, the grid disk 1 can rotate, and then the thermocouple on the grid disk 1 is dumped out.
[0023] See also Figures 1 to 5 The two inner walls on the inner side of the packaging frame 2 are movably connected with a positioning plate 9 with an arc-shaped upper surface. The positioning plate 9 can move along a fixed track on the packaging frame 2, and under the action of the arc structure on the positioning plate 9, the grid disk 1 can smoothly pass through the positioning plate 9 and contact with the positioning plate 9. One end of the positioning plate 9 extends into the packaging frame 2 and is fixed with a first spring 10. One end of the first spring 10 is fixed to the packaging frame 2. Under the action of the elastic force of the first spring 10, the positioning plate 9 can push the grid disk 1 to automatically position to calibrate the relative position of the slot 21.
[0024] See also Figures 1 to 5 , slots 21 are provided in the middle of both sides of the grid disk 1, and the slots 21 can be plugged into the cross-linked shaft 17, so that the cross-linked shaft 17 can drive the grid disk 1 to rotate, and one end of the cross-linked shaft 17 extends out of the packaging frame 2 and is fixedly connected to the electric push rod 20. Driven by the electric push rod 20, the cross-linked shaft 17 can move, so that the cross-linked shaft 17 can be retracted, and one end of the electric push rod 20 is fixedly connected to the disc 16, and the outer sides of the two ends of the packaging frame 2 are fixedly connected to the fixing frame 15, and the disc 16 is movably mounted on the fixing frame 15, and the disc 16 can be rotated in a fixed position on the fixing frame 15 to ensure that the electric push rod 20 can rotate, so that the rotation of the cross-linked shaft 17 can proceed smoothly.
[0025] See also Figures 1 to 5One end of the two movable plates 14 extends out of the packaging frame 2 and is fixedly connected to the first transmission frame 7 and the second transmission frame 8 respectively. Driven by the first transmission frame 7 and the second transmission frame 8 respectively, the two movable plates 14 move relative to each other. One end of the rotating cylinder 18 extends out of the packaging frame 2 and is fixedly connected to the gear ring 19. Driven by the gear ring 19, the rotating cylinder 18 can rotate. The two ends of the first transmission frame 7 and the second transmission frame 8 are respectively engaged with the two gear rings 19, thereby enabling the first transmission frame 7 and the second transmission frame 8 to move relative to each other.
[0026] See also Figures 1 to 5 The outer side of one end of the packaging frame 2 is connected to a gear 3 through a rotating shaft. The gear 3 can rotate at a fixed position on the packaging frame 2, and a motor 4 is fixedly connected to one of the fixing frames 15. The output shaft of the motor 4 passes through the fixing frame 15 and is connected to the gear 3. Driven by the output shaft of the motor 4, the gear 3 can rotate. The motor 4 is a prior art and will not be described here.
[0027] See also Figures 1 to 5 The other end of the movable plate 14 is movably connected with a plurality of support columns 12, and the support columns 12 can move vertically relative to the movable plate 14. The top of the support column 12 is fixed with a support plate 11, and the bottom of the support plate 11 contacts the bottom of the grid disk 1, and the grid disk 1 can be supported by the support plate 11, and a second spring 13 is sleeved on the support column 12, and the top of the second spring 13 is fixed to the bottom of the support plate 11, and the bottom end of the second spring 13 is fixed to the movable plate 14. Under the action of the elastic force of the second spring 13, the support plate 11 can support the grid disk 1, and at the beginning of the rotation of the grid disk 1, the corner of the grid disk 1 can smoothly push the support plate 11 to ensure the smooth rotation of the grid disk 1.
[0028] In summary, when the platinum-rhodium wire thermocouple finished product packaging equipment is used, the grid disk 1 is placed in the grid disk 1 and the grid disk 1 is pushed downward. The grid disk 1 first passes through the positioning plate 9, and both sides of the grid disk 1 contact the inner wall of the packaging frame 2. When the grid disk 1 contacts the support plate 11 and is placed on the support plate 11, the positioning plate 9 is pushed by the elastic force of the first spring 10, so that the grid disk 1 can automatically correct its position, so that the slot 21 is aligned with the cross-linked shaft 17, and then under the push of the electric push rod 20, the cross-linked shaft 17 is moved and inserted into the slot 21, and then driven by the output shaft of the motor 4, the gear 3 is able to rotate, and then the gear ring 1 9 rotates, and driven by the gear ring 19, the rotating cylinder 18 rotates, and then the cross-linking shaft 17 drives the grid disk 1 to rotate, and under the action of the rotation of the grid disk 1, the thermocouple placed on the grid disk 1 is dumped out and falls into the packaging bag installed on the support frame 5, and under the action of the rotation of the gear ring 19, the first transmission frame 7 and the second transmission frame 8 move relative to each other, and drive the two movable plates 14 to move relative to each other, so that the support plate 11 is out of contact with the grid disk 1, so that the grid disk 1 can rotate smoothly. At the same time, after the cross-linking shaft 17 is pulled out of the slot 21, the grid disk 1 can smoothly fall through the packaging frame 2 to discharge the material.
